Transaction 57c2b66e7a2037a6e52e6bae0618e01c8369596af58c19e44cc288ae47cafedf
1 Input
2 Outputs
- 57c2b66e7a2037a6e52e6bae0618e01c8369596af58c19e44cc288ae47cafedf:0
- 57c2b66e7a2037a6e52e6bae0618e01c8369596af58c19e44cc288ae47cafedf:1
value 49479748
address 3EikvBpwyiz9SPLms8TKkz8Szga6e7dfwt
value 3405008863
address 1FPNPzoxKtH3rrq8VfGhabg69ZGRZeJgfy